Zambia Vs Egypt
Heroes Stadium
15:00hrs

Forget the 6-1 drubbing Zambia inflicted on Mali last Wednesday in the second game of the host in the group. This game will be played out between a completely different scenario and different conditions. Egypt know that anything less than a victory is disaster for them while Zambia would want to continue giving the fans the best atmosphere at Heroes Stadium. I think Bestone Chambeshi will put up a strong team but its likely that he won’t use the players on yellow cards to risk having them miss out the semi final. The Zambian players should know that there is no link between the Wednesday match and this one. I am sure the game with Egypt will be a great match but it has nothing to do with the last one as the next one is different.

That incredible game against Mali was also played in the Heroes Stadium and there is a serious danger on Zambia to think they can easily run riot against the Egyptian team who seriously need to win. Egypt allowed Guinea to come back in their last encounter , they could effectively had less pressure in this encounter but this is now a tough one and they need three points to qualify. That’s what makes this encounter interesting.

Most of the Egypt side have never played in a match this big before, this is a hero making game and the Pharoahs may just make themselves heroes. According to what I saw in the Mali game , Zambia has the necessary know-how to deal with the pressure of this magnitude.

Mali Vs Guinea
Levy Mwanawasa Stadium
15:00
Another interesting encounter in the making and this one will be a dead rubber if Egypt win their game against Zambia. Egypt will qualify with a win and won’t care of what happens in Ndola. It is a situation were these two teams will be supporting Zambia but also making sure there is a winner to join the host in the semi final.
I still repeat that Mali is an exceptional team and plays the best football. Guinea will feel the pressure of this Mali team that will be hoping to give their fans an eraser of the 6-1 hauling against Zambia.

I think they can do it by sending Guinea back home.
I think Mali will beat Guinea and qualify to the semi final with a Zambian win against Egypt.

My Verdict: Mali 2-0 Guinea
